Originally designed as a battlecruiser, its hull is very sleek, and it adopted an enclosed bow, which was rare for an aircraft carrier during the war. Another major feature is the huge funnel that rises almost in the center of the starboard side, with the bridge equipped with twin 5-inch anti-aircraft guns positioned in front of it. It boasts the longest overall length of any aircraft carrier that fought in the Pacific War. During the war, the Saratoga participated in many operations, sustaining damage and undergoing numerous refits to survive. In the Battle of the Santa Cruz Islands in October of the same year, its aircraft sank the American aircraft carrier Hornet. After that, it continued to fight as the core of the task force until the end of the war in battles such as the Third Battle of the Solomon Islands and the Battle of the Philippine Sea. Although planned as the third ship of the Yamato-class battleships, it was converted after the defeat at the Battle of Midway and completed as an aircraft carrier on November 19, 1944. With a waterline length of 266m, a trial displacement of 62,000t, and strong side armor inherited from the Yamato, it boasted heavy protection with an armored flight deck that could withstand a direct hit from a 500kg bomb. However, it capsized after being torpedoed by an American submarine on its way to outfitting work. Based on the operational experience of the previously completed \"Soryu\" and \"Kaga,\" the \"Hiryu\" was designed to have its bridge located in the center of the hull so as not to interfere with the launching aircraft. However, since it would have been above the smokestack on the starboard side, it was placed on the port side. While this was a favorable arrangement in terms of weight distribution, it was then discovered that the airflow generated from the bridge had a negative impact on landing aircraft. Therefore, in aircraft carriers built after this, the bridge was placed on the starboard side, making the \"Hiryu\" and \"Akagi\" the only ones with a bridge on the port side, giving them a unique appearance. Nevertheless, it became an extremely successful and powerful aircraft carrier, boasting high-speed performance exceeding 34 knots, improved hull strength, enhanced defensive capabilities, and a carrying capacity of 57 aircraft. The Hiryu's combat record began with supporting the continental invasion operation in 1940, followed by the surprise attack on Pearl Harbor on December 8, 1941, the capture of Wake Island, the mopping-up operations in Java and New Guinea, and the Indian Ocean operation, where its dive bomber squadrons achieved an astonishing hit rate, sinking the British aircraft carrier HMS Hermes and the heavy cruiser HMS Cornwall. Then, at the end of May 1942, the Hiryu departed Japan to participate in the fateful Battle of Midway. In the early morning of June 5, 1942, Lieutenant Commander Tomonaga of the Hiryu judged the first attack to be insufficient and requested a land attack, leading to the hectic situation of changing the equipment of the air force units that had been waiting on the carrier with ship attack equipment to land attack equipment. Furthermore, after receiving reports from reconnaissance planes of the enemy task force's discovery, the air force's equipment was once again changed to ship-attack equipment—an unusual situation. At that moment, three ships, the Akagi, Kaga, and Soryu, were instantly set ablaze by dive bombing attacks from an incoming US dive bomber squadron. The Hiryu was the only ship undamaged and began attacking the US aircraft carriers, rendering the US aircraft carrier Yorktown unable to sail. However, bombing attacks from attack squadrons launched from the remaining two carriers hit the ship with four bombs and suffered two near misses, causing it to catch fire and become unable to sail. Judging that rescue was hopeless, the destroyers Arashi and Nowaki launched torpedo attacks and it was thought to have sunk.
